Abstract

Now available in Spanish, this is part of a series of publications by David C. Diehl and Stephanie C. Toelle that addresses media and its effects on young children, from birth to age six. The series is designed to reach both professional educators and parents and to provide research summaries, tips for parents, and internet resources for further information.
